  • Watch Final Whistle Present Side Entry every Thursday night at 19:00 on the Rugby channel, with episodes also available on Catch Up.
    Sacha Feinberg-Mngomezulu has been included in the Springbok squad for the Castle Lager Incoming Series, with Jordan Hendrikse and Siya Masuku on the standby list. Victor Matfield & Swys de Bruin debate who should be the third-choice flyhalf behind Handre Pollard and Manie Libbok.
